The Core Difference: Fixed vs. Adjustable Designs

Feature Fixed Industrial Hinges Adjustable Industrial Hinges
Alignment tolerance ±2.0 mm (typical) ±0.3 mm (achievable)
On-site correction Requires shimming or re-welding In-place screw/pin adjustment
Installation time 15–20 minutes per unit 25–30 minutes per unit
Post-installation rework rate 12–18% <3%
Typical price premium Baseline +40% to +70%

The table above highlights that adjustable variants from Yitai incorporate eccentric bushings, slotted mounting plates, or cam-action pivot pins. These mechanisms allow vertical, horizontal, and angular corrections without unbolting the entire assembly—a critical advantage when substrates (steel frames, concrete anchors, or aluminum extrusions) are not perfectly true.


Three Scenarios Where Adjustable Hinges Pay Back Rapidly

  1. Multi-panel synchronized doors – On production lines where two leaves must meet at a centre seal, even 1 mm of droop creates air leaks or particle ingress. Adjustable Hardware Industrial Hinges enable micro-adjustments after thermal expansion cycles.

  2. Retrofitting existing openings – Old factory walls rarely maintain original plumb. Adjustable models from Yitai accommodate +/- 5° of misalignment, eliminating costly structural rework.

  3. High-frequency cycling equipment – Vibratory conveyors and punch presses gradually shift fixed hinge positions. With adjustable types, maintenance crews perform 5-minute realignments instead of 2-hour replacements.


Total Cost of Ownership (TCO) Comparison over 5 Years

Cost Component Fixed Hinges (per 100 units) Adjustable Hinges (per 100 units)
Initial purchase $2,800 $4,200
Installation labour $1,200 $1,600
Rework during commissioning $840 (estimated) $120 (estimated)
Unscheduled downtime (5 yrs) $3,500 (avg. 3 events) $700 (avg. 0.5 events)
Replacement parts $950 $200
5-Year Total $9,290 $6,820

This analysis demonstrates that while adjustable Hardware Industrial Hinges carry higher ticket prices, their total cost over five years is roughly 27% lower—primarily due to reduced downtime and rework. FAQ – Common Questions About Adjustable Hardware Industrial Hinges

Q1: Can adjustable Hardware Industrial Hinges handle the same dynamic loads as equivalent fixed models?
A: Yes, provided the adjustment mechanism is locked properly. Reputable brands like Yitai rate their adjustable hinges with dynamic load capacities equal to fixed counterparts (e.g., 250 kg per pair for medium-duty series). The locking systems—whether set screws, jam nuts, or clamp plates—are engineered to sustain shear and tensile forces without slipping. However, it is critical to verify that the adjustment range does not reduce the thread engagement or bearing surface area. For applications with continuous vibration above 10 G, Yitai recommends applying medium-strength threadlocker on all adjustment fasteners after final positioning. Always consult the supplier’s load charts, as cheap alternatives often derate their adjustable products by 15–20% without disclosure.

Q2: How often should adjustable Hardware Industrial Hinges be re-calibrated in normal production conditions?
A: For most indoor manufacturing environments, a semi-annual check suffices. Yitai’s field data indicates that properly torqued adjustable hinges retain their settings for over 2,000 operating hours in clean, low-vibration settings. In harsh conditions—such as foundries with thermal swings of 40°C per shift or outdoor material handling—quarterly inspections are prudent. The recalibration process itself takes under 2 minutes per hinge using a simple dial indicator or laser alignment tool. More importantly, regular inspections allow early detection of bushing wear before it affects door function. Q3: Are adjustable Hardware Industrial Hinges compatible with existing hinge cut-outs or mounting hole patterns?
A: This depends on the product series. Yitai offers two footprints: “direct-replacement” types that match standard 4-hole and 6-hole patterns (96 mm x 80 mm, 120 mm x 100 mm), and “universal” types with elongated slots that adapt to misaligned holes from previous installations. Direct-replacement models require no new hole drilling, making them ideal for upgrade projects. The universal variants, while slightly more expensive, accept hole centre variations up to 8 mm horizontally and 5 mm vertically. Practical Recommendation

For precision alignment needs involving:

  • Tolerances tighter than ±1.0 mm

  • Doors exceeding 50 kg

  • At least 5 adjustment events expected over the hinge’s life

Choose adjustable Hardware Industrial Hinges from Yitai without hesitation.

For purely decorative, static, or low-weight applications (under 20 kg with no alignment criticality), fixed hinges remain economically viable.
